Pandas timestamp to datetime with timezone. Timestamp ¶ class pandas.
Pandas timestamp to datetime with timezone. Pandas offers the DatetimeIndex object, which allows us to work with time series data efficiently. tz. datetime objects being returned (possibly inside an Index or a Series with object dtype) instead of a proper pandas designated type I have two datetime columns which are naive when I read them into memory but which are in US/Eastern actually. In this tutorial we will learn about how to This snippet shows how to create a DataFrame with a timezone-aware DateTimeIndex and convert it to another time zone. 1 is timestamp (imported from excel) and the other is datetime. Timestamp ¶ class pandas. freqstr or pandas offset object, optional One of pandas date offset strings or corresponding objects. I'd like to convert the timezone of this timestamp to 'US/Pacific' and add it as a hierarchical index to a pandas DataFrame. Let’s say you’re working with data that has timestamps in UTC. replace (tzinfo=None) This is the efficient way to remove timezone information. today # classmethod Timestamp. To demonstrate datetime handling with time zones in pandas let’s use the following array of datetime values loaded into the data frame: I did refer to previous postings but they seem to convert to datetime as easily as possible: Convert datetime columns to a different timezone pandas Convert pandas timezone If I have a pandas DataFrame with timestamp column (1546300800000, 1546301100000, 1546301400000, 1546301700000, 1546302000000) and I want to convert this result: Timestamp('2022-08-24 13:53:23. Timestamp ¶ Pandas replacement for datetime. Any In pandas, a powerful data analysis library for Python, the to_datetime function is a versatile tool for working with dates and times pandas. Parameters: tzstr or timezone object, default None pandas. Note that pandas (in contrast to native Python) does not The Timestamp object in Pandas represents a single point in time, similar to Python’s datetime. to_datetime () 文字列を Timestamp 型に変換するには pd. tz_convert method AI時代を生き抜くエンジニアのように、このトピックをしっかりマスターしていきましょう!エポックタイムスタンプをpd. DatetimeIndex can be created in many ways. If the data has a time zone, the following code works successfully: col = pandas. tz_convert(*args, **kwargs) [source] # Convert tz-aware Datetime Array/Index from one time zone to another. Timestamp. Timestamp and localizing it to To convert a time in one timezone to another timezone in Python, you could use datetime. If True, the function always returns a timezone-aware UTC-localized Timestamp, Series or DatetimeIndex. You need to To work with time zones, pandas offers methods to localize timestamps to a specific time zone or convert timestamps between different time zones. Timestamp and pandas. Convert timezones before merging or comparing datetime values. Using the NumPy datetime64 and timedelta64 dtypes, I have multiple data frames with a datetime column as a string. now # classmethod Timestamp. Then, by using the This method is used to convert a timezone-aware Timestamp object to a different time zone. It’s the type used for the entries that make up a DatetimeIndex, and other A DatetimeIndex is a specialized Pandas index composed of Timestamp objects, designed to label rows or columns with datetime values. read_csv(). fff', which doesn't have timezone The UTC in squared brackets denotes that the timezone information is included which is actually UTC timestamp. The original UTC time remains the same; only the time zone information is changed. astimezone # Timestamp. Return type depends on input (types in parenthesis correspond to fallback in case of unsuccessful timezone or out-of-range timestamp parsing): utcbool, default False Control timezone-related parsing, localization and conversion. today () in that it can be localized to a passed Pandas provides the Timestamp object, which is a stand-in for Python’s datetime but with a more powerful set of functionalities. I'm provided the following data (MySQL data type is Time series / date functionality # pandas contains extensive capabilities and features for working with time series data for all domains. tz_localize(tz, ambiguous='raise', nonexistent='raise') # Localize the Timestamp to a timezone. tz_localize('US/Central') is wrong if df['datetime'] is naive datetime that was converted from Unix time. The ‘timestamp’ column contains datetime values, while the ‘timezone’ column Problem I've got a column in a pandas DataFrame that contains timestamps with timezones. to_pydatetime() function to convert the pandas Timestamp objects to regular Python datetime objects. tzfile or None Time zone for time which Timestamp will be converted to. Modify the output 文字列からTimestamp型に変換: pd. to_datetime(df["col"], utc=True) to ensure consistency in timezone-aware timestamps. True - the function always returns a timezone-aware UTC-localized Timestamp, Series or DatetimeIndex. I would like to convert the following pandas series containing UNIX timestamps into a pandas datetime using either to_datetime() or arrow library in Python. tz_localize # Timestamp. e. We can install the package using the following code. datetime format which I Let’s now explore the different methods to do this efficiently. datetime but optimized for Pandas’ data structures. For handling time zones, we localize naive pywintypes. It is because we If a date does not meet the timestamp limitations, passing errors=’ignore’ will return the original input instead of raising any exception. Resources I have about 800,000 rows of data in a dataframe, and one column of the data df['Date'] is string of time and date 'YYYY-MM-DD HH:MM:SS. A timezone-aware I need to merge 2 pandas dataframes together on dates, but they currently have different date types. Convert naive Timestamp to local time zone or I read Pandas change timezone for forex DataFrame but I'd like to make the time column of my dataframe timezone naive for interoperability with an sqlite3 database. The following causes are responsible for datetime. Here we focus on the time zone issues surrounding them; A succinct way to apply the timezone localization to each individual timestamp in a pandas series, the lambda function encapsulates creating a pd. tz_convert() method is a powerful tool for managing time series data in Python, especially when dealing with data across multiple time zones. to_datetime() format option %Z recognize short form of Learn how to work with time zones in pandas time series data - converting between time zones, localizing naive timestamps, and handling time zone pandas. tz_convert(tz) [source] # Convert tz-aware Datetime Array/Index from one time zone to another. tzfile, datetime. Series. datetime objects being returned (possibly inside an Index or a Series with object dtype) instead of a proper pandas designated type You can use tz_localize to set the timezone to UTC /+0000, and then tz_convert to add the timezone you want: print (df) Date a. If warn=True, issue a warning 0 I want to convert a timestamp in a string format which I get out of a pandas dataframe to a timestamp in datetime format in order to be able to compare it to another I have a pandas dataframe with a datetime column of the following values: The following causes are responsible for datetime. Using the NumPy datetime64 and timedelta64 dtypes, pandas. dt. This method takes a time zone (tz) In this tutorial, we'll look at how to remove the timezone info from a datetime column in a Pandas DataFrame. Datetime formats vary across columns in the dataframe or across dataframes. timezone, dateutil. These timestamps can Pandas deals with datetime objects very well. Passing None will remove the time zone Timestamps ¶ pandas. tz_convert # Series. to_pydatetime(warn=True) # Convert a Timestamp object to a native Python datetime object. Pandas provides straightforward methods to Parameters: dataarray-like (1-dimensional) Datetime-like data to construct index with. Then you can use tz_convert, i. 425 I use pandas. Passing errors=’coerce’ will force an out-of-bounds date . It serves as the backbone for time I'd like to set the time zone of the values of a column in a Pandas DataFrame. datetime(2020, 11, 24, 14, 59, 9, tzinfo=TimeZoneInfo('GMT Standard Time', True)) Since I am using win32com library, the time is extracted in pywintypes. to_pydatetime # Timestamp. tz_convert () function allows for easy conversion of timezone-aware datetime indices in a DataFrame to a This code snippet creates a DataFrame with a ‘UTC_Timestamp’ column, converts it to datetime, and then uses Pytz to first localize to UTC before converting to ‘Asia/Tokyo’ pandas. tzinfo or None Time zone to convert timestamps to. To do this, timezone-naive Converting Timestamps with Timezones to Datetime. This Pandas Convert Timestamp to datetimedate As a data scientist or software engineer, you may often encounter datasets that contain timestamps. This function is ideal when your I have a frequently changing pandas dataframe of data that looks like this: date name time timezone 0 2016-08-01 aaa 0900 Asia/Tokyo 1 2016-08-04 bbb 1200 Europe/Berlin 2 Timestamp is the pandas equivalent of python’s Datetime and is interchangeable with it in most cases. date. Mastering Timezone Handling in Pandas for Time Series Analysis Time series analysis is a cornerstone of data science, enabling insights into temporal trends across This method involves using the tz_convert function of pandas’ DateTimeIndex to convert the timestamp to a specified time zone. now(tz=None) # Return new Timestamp object representing current time local to tz. There are two different timezones present in this column, and I need to ensure that Time series / date functionality # pandas contains extensive capabilities and features for working with time series data for all domains. df6. datetime Timestamp is the pandas equivalent of python’s Datetime and is interchangeable with it in Use pd. timezone, either somehow get a full timezone name Europe/Moscow instead of short MSK from my python code, or make pandas. to_datetimeで変換すると、デフォルトでUTC(協 How to read datetime with timezone in pandas Asked 11 years, 11 months ago Modified 3 years, 8 months ago Viewed 34k times Convert timezone-aware Timestamp to another time zone. tz_localize(*args, **kwargs) [source] # Localize tz-naive Datetime Array/Index to tz-aware Datetime Array/Index. The I have data with a time-stamp in UTC. It’s the type used for the entries that make up a DatetimeIndex, and other df['datetime']. tz_convert () function allows for easy conversion of timezone-aware datetime indices in a DataFrame to a Localize tz-naive DatetimeIndex to a given time zone, or remove timezone from a tz-aware DatetimeIndex. How to convert unix epoch time to datetime with timezone in pandas Asked 4 years, 4 months ago Modified 4 years, 4 months ago Viewed 9k times I assume you have a pandas series because the data you posted looks like one. It doesn't change the I have a table with time-stamped data, like this: How do I convert the entire TimeStamp column from UTC to local time with the pytz This method involves using the pandas. Dealing with time zones in pandas is like ensuring everyone shows up to the global meeting at the right hour. DatetimeIndex. import pandas as pd pd. Now, we'll explore how to work with Learn how to work with time zones in pandas time series data - converting between time zones, localizing naive timestamps, and handling time zone aware operations. This guide provides step-by-step instructions and examples. Datetimes and Timezones can be easily misunderstood or take a long time when dealing with pandas. I've been I'm importing data into pandas and want to remove any timezones – if they're present in the data. to_datetime to parse the dates in my data. to_datetime() 関数を使う。 Handling time zones is crucial for data analysis, particularly when dealing with timestamps across different time zones. Think of a Pandas Timestamp as a supercharged version of Python’s datetime —it’s optimized for handling date and time data in large A simple guide to work with dates, timestamps, periods, time deltas, and time zones using Python library Pandas. It serves as the To that end, pass tz=None. Using datetime. datetime objects being returned (possibly inside an Index or a Series with object dtype) instead of a proper pandas designated type Next, we will create a sample dataframe with two columns: ‘timestamp’ and ‘timezone’. I simply want to convert both of these columns to Overview The pandas. set_index("gmtime", inplace=True) #correct the underscores in old The following causes are responsible for datetime. The method is specifically In Pandas, DataFrame. Let’s sync our watches. It’s a good approach when building new In Pandas, DataFrame. With the tz parameter, we can change the DatetimeIndex to other time zones: In this tutorial, we'll use the Pandas package. to_datetime('2020-10 Python Pandas: How to Convert Timezone-Aware DateTimeIndex to Naive Timestamps Working with time-series data in Pandas often involves handling timezones. Tutorial covers aspects like creating How to Convert Timezones For tz-aware DateTime Series To convert timezones from one timezone to another in a tz-aware DateTime Series we use the dt. The data in my pandas Learn about pandas to_datetime using multiple examples to convert String, Series, DataFrame into DateTime Index. tz_localize # Series. Convert naive Timestamp to local time zone or Are you working with datetime data in pandas? Learn how to become "timezone-aware" so that your dataset cooperates with Daylight Timestamp is the pandas equivalent of python’s Datetime and is interchangeable with it in most cases. Parameters: tzstr, pytz. I am reading the DataFrame with pandas. pandas. Pandas by default represents the dates with datetime64[ns] even though the dates pandas. Pandas provides rich support for working with timestamps in different Returns datetime If parsing succeeded. I want to get a unix timestamp Learn how to convert a naive timestamp to a local time zone in Python using Pandas. today(tz=None) # Return the current time in the local timezone. 983624') Pandas to_datetime - naive or aware Pandas to_datetime method has parameter: utc: True - the Also read: Pandas date_range – Return a fixed frequency DatetimeIndex Why is Pandas to_datetime used? This function is used to 2023-04-01 12:00:00 This snippet creates a Timestamp object with Pandas and then converts it to a Python datetime object using the to_pydatetime() method. timezone, Pandas 使用时区在pandas to_datetime函数中 在本文中,我们将介绍如何在Pandas的to_datetime函数中使用时区。 阅读更多: Pandas 教程 什么是时区? 时区是指地 A step-by-step guide on how to convert a Pandas timezone-aware DateTimeIndex to a naive timestamp in a certain timezone. This differs from datetime. astimezone (): so, below code is to convert the local time to other time zone. tzfile or None I have multiple csv files, I've set DateTime as the index. tz_convert # DatetimeIndex. None will pandas. astimezone(tz) # Convert timezone-aware Timestamp to another time zone. The short answer of this utcbool, default False Control timezone-related parsing, localization and conversion. Converting a timezone-aware DateTimeIndex to a naive timestamp while preserving the original timezone can often be a complex task in Python, especially with the Closed 6 years ago. The DatetimeIndex object supports time zone-awareness, making it convenient to convert and I have been pulling my hair out trying to convert a provided time from a MYSQL database in Pandas that has a time offset. yx rn cn jx xm zr qz zw tp yk